Police searching for masked man after German Shepherd puppy stolen from Petland McKinney

McKinney, Texas -- Police in McKinney are searching for information related to a theft of a 10-week-old male, black and tan German Shepherd puppy, stolen from the Petland store located in Craig Crossing at 3190 S. Central Expressway earlier today. Store surveillance video shows the suspect arriving at Petland McKinney on foot, at approximately 10:15 a.m. He was wearing what appeared to be a head covering similar to a ski mask, with the lower half of his face covered. 

Once inside, the man was greeted by a staff member and acknowledged them with a wave. The suspect walked toward the employee, pulling down the facial covering when he spoke with them. He asked to visit with the German Shepherd puppy; and on his own, entered the playroom closest to the front door as the employee was getting the puppy. 

The man began acting as if he was filling out a credit application, and within five minutes, he picked up the puppy and rushed to the door. The employee was stationed near the front of the store and is seen in a surveillance video asking for the puppy. The suspect refused and began running once outside the store. The employee chased him for a short time but lost the suspect as he ran toward a nearby housing development. As with all Petland puppies, the black and tan German Shepherd is microchipped and has been reported stolen. 

A passerby later took a photo of the suspect with the puppy in his arms while he was spotted waiting to cross a street in the shopping area. The photo shows the man’s full face and the size of the puppy. The suspect appears to be Black, tall and thin and wearing glasses. In addition to the head and face covering, he entered the store wearing a green baseball cap, dark pants and dark t-shirt with the character Betty Boop on the front.
